Makeup makes the world go round. Whether you're a casual Covergirl user or you're a hardcore Anastasia Beverly Hills addict who just bought Urban Decay's $400 brush vault, you know that makeup is one of the few things on Earth that can just connect people. Hopefully if you're as addicted to makeup as I am, you'll appreciate these 11 facts that you definitely know are totally true.

1) You know that when you see a new palette in a magazine or online, it takes an extreme level of self control to not go out and splurge immediately.

2) You know that all brands are not created equal. Sometimes, it's okay to splurge a little for quality!

3) You know that when you or someone you know cakes their foundation, they really look like this-

4) You know that there's nothing worse than seeing foundation two shades darker than a girl's neck.

5) You know that waking up to makeup makes the mornings 100x easier.

6) You know that having your winged eyeliner sharp enough is a 100% legitimate reason for being late.

7) You know that no foundation is good enough to hide acne. It's a curse.

8) You know that payday should actually be renamed "Sephora Day"

9) You know that any boy who says that makeup is "basically lying" is a boy who nobody should be spending their time with.

10) You have a favorite makeup guru and you know that an entire afternoon spent watching their Youtube videos is not time being wasted.

11) Finally, you know that makeup makes you feel so much more confidant about yourself. You wouldn't stop wearing it for anyone!
